Robert De Niro on Trump: "He's A Mutt"

Robert De Niro isn't President Trump's number one fan... that's no secret. In past interviews, De Niro has said "he's blatantly stupid. He's a punk. He's a dog. He's a pig. A con. A Bu**sh!t artist..." of our president, and the list definitely goes on. 

He has also said, "I'd like to punch him in the face." His words are far from sensitized, but at least he lets us know how he feels? 

In a new interview on Fox’s Good Day New York to promote the upcoming TriBeCa Film Festival, De Niro revealed that his feelings about the commander in chief have not changed.

Rosanna Scotto asked him about the presidency, specifically referencing cutting funding to the arts. De Niro answered, “I can’t articulate it well enough other than to say it’s ridiculous... This is guy has sullied the presidency, he’s debased the presidency.”
